M. Jimenez et R. Mateo, DETERMINATION OF MYCOTOXINS PRODUCED BY FUSARIUM ISOLATES FROM BANANAFRUITS BY CAPILLARY GAS-CHROMATOGRAPHY AND HIGH-PERFORMANCE LIQUID-CHROMATOGRAPHY, Journal of chromatography, 778(1-2), 1997, pp. 363-372

A method of analysis for trichothecenes (nivalenol, deoxynivalenol, 3-
and 15-acetyldeoxynivalenol, diacetoxyscirpenol, neosolaniol, T-2 tet
raol, T-2 and HT-2 toxins), zearalenone and zearalenols, and another m
ethod for determination of fumonisin B-1 are described and applied to
cultures of Fusarium isolated from bananas. Both methods were adapted
from different techniques of extraction, clean-up and determination of
these mycotoxins. The first method involves extraction with methanol-
1% aqueous sodium chloride, clean-up of extracts by partition with hex
ane and dichloromethane, additional solid reversed-phase clean-up and
analysis of two eluates by both high-performance liquid chromatography
with ultraviolet detection and capillary gas chromatography. The meth
od for fumonisin B-1 implies extraction with aqueous methanol, concent
ration, clean-up with water and methanol on Amberlite XAD-2 column, fo
rmation of a fluorescent 4-fluoro-7-nitrobenzofurazan derivative and a
nalysis by high-performance liquid chromatography with fluorescence de
tection. Both procedures give good limits of detection and recoveries,
and are considered suitable for the detection and quantification of t
he studied toxins in corn and rice cultures of Fusarium spp. isolated
from banana fruits. (C) 1997 Elsevier Science B.V.
